SIDE NOTE: Fancy Widget
A great addition to Launcher Pro is another free Android app called Fancy Widget. Basically it gives you a HTC Style clock and Weather widget for your homescreen. However it is smaller and in my opinion cleaner looking than the HTC. it has a clean and simple design which grabs your location via GPS, and updates your weather. A simple click of the icon gives you the next 5 days. Adding this is a real improvement over the Orange clock and weather widgets. So much faster to load too!
STYLE & SPEED - Android Apps to Give you a boost
Launcher Pro - Price of App FREE
GET THIS APP RIGHT NOW! Launcher Pro is quite possible the most important app you can download for your Orange San Francisco or other Android phone. It replaces the stock Orange launcher with a slick interface, which not only looks better and more expensive (very similar to HTC Desire style), but it considerably smooths and speeds up swipes across homescreens. It truly is an amazing app. Not only does it speed your phone up for everyday usage, but it can give you up to 7 home screens. Making it more than a match for Android 2.2 on that front. It can do more than just improve your homescreens, it also modifies the app screen. It can turn your app drawer list into a fast 3D swipe fest. Its really impressive how they can make these changes, offering more homescreens, a 3D environment yet still improve the speed of the phone over the Orange stock layout. That is how you program! Advanced Task Killer - Price FREE
My one gripe with Android is a lot of the Apps stay open, and can even open themselves in the background. This sucks juice form the battery as well as slows your phone down. Enter Advanced Task Killer. It has a simple interface, and due to its name is usually at the top of your App Drawer allowing you to cancel off Facebook, Orange Apps, and others which love to saps your battery dry. Its such a simple app but great to use. It is not intrusive in any way and a great piece of kit. Look for the little guy in the Android Market place.
SwiftKey Trial - FREE
The Orange San Francisco features the standard Android keyboard and TouchPal. I personally find the standard keyboard hard to work with in portrait, which the TouchPal one is frustrating with how it handles predictive text, whilst also looks rubbish. SwiftKey features the best of both keyboards for Android whilst fixing a lot. It has a superb predictive text feature in which it shows three words above the keyboard which you can click to add, however they even feature words that start with letters next to the one you may have pressed by accident. It sounds clumsy but it really works well and sped up my texting within about 3 messages. It even predicts phrases like How > Are > You > Feeling >?. So you can type that in 5 key presses. Impressive stuff, and it also look great! Only problem is its only a trial. I may have to purchase this one unless there is a clone around.

Barcode Scanner - FREE
This is a superb app, and one of the free scanner apps that are for the UK. It works very accurately and in conjunction with Google Shopper you can do price searches in £££! It's one of the better apps too as you dont need to take a picture, it auto focuses using your San Francisco and scans without you needing to press anything. Great app that does exactly what you want it to and more. You then get links to Google Shopper, Image search or Google Search. Nice and free, yet can save you money when out and about.
UPDATE: ShopSavvy - I came across this recently. It is better than Barcode Scanner in my opinion as it lays out the different online retailers in a clearer way. It also has virtually every big online retailer. I havent used the feature but you can also set price alerts so it messages you if a price drops. Again its free so see what you prefer, but I now recommend ShopSavvy over Barcode scanner.
SyncMyPix - FREE
This app is by no means perfect but it is a handy app even if you just use it once. Basically it allows you to sync your friends pictures from Facebook to become their photo for when they call you from your contacts. Sometimes it forgets what you have matched which is annoying, but you only really need to run it once to get a picture of your friends. Handy as Android can be slow in doing this manually.
